What "first aid" covers today

Modern emergency treatment training is expertise based and maps to nationwide devices of proficiency. The typical ones you'll see in Cannon Hill are:

    HLTAID009 Supply cardiopulmonary resuscitation, usually called a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course. HLTAID011 Provide First Aid, previously called Degree 2 or Senior Citizen First Aid. HLTAID012 Give Emergency treatment in an education and treatment setup, typically called Child care First Aid.

Those units define the minimum skill and understanding you must show to be regarded experienced. An excellent supplier will certainly go beyond the minimum, providing added technique rounds, situation selection, and neighborhood context. In Cannon Hill, that may consist of dealing with warmth health problem on a sporting activities field, taking care of a bicyclist fall near Creek Road, or replying to a yard pool emergency.

What you really discover and practice

A solid emergency treatment training Cannon Hillside day is kinetic. You will stoop, roll, press, bandage, and speak to substitute casualties. Expect to take another look at the DRSABCD technique continuously up until it ends up being automated. For CPR and first aid course Cannon Hillside sessions, trainers often mix adult, kid, and infant scenarios to mirror what takes place in genuine life.

CPR criteria call for compressions at 100 to 120 per minute with a depth of one third of the chest in infants and kids and regarding 5 to 6 centimetres in adults, with complete recoil. Educating manikins currently track compression depth and rate. The device doesn't exist, which is why a 10-minute technique can feel like a workout. Up and down tested individuals often have a hard time to strike deepness on adult manikins. Instructors show method adjustments, like positioning closer to the hips for utilize, or using a step mat for height.

For first a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Cannon Hillside training courses, you'll also cover:

    How to acknowledge and deal with serious blood loss, consisting of using pressure bandages and tourniquets. Choking monitoring across age. Asthma and anaphylaxis methods, including fitness instructor EpiPen and spacer method. Stroke acknowledgment making use of FAST and what to do with borderline signs and symptoms. Shock and spinal precautions without over immobilisation. Burns emergency treatment with regional considerations, like tidy running water cooling for 20 minutes and staying clear of ice or oily creams. Diabetes emergency situations, seizures, high temperatures in youngsters, and fainting.

Childcare First Aid Cannon Hillside training courses go deeper on pediatric top priorities. You'll practice baby m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, febrile convulsion management, risk-free healing placements for tiny bodies, and the usefulness of overseeing a team while isolating a kid with believed contagious health problem. Experienced child care trainers share little operational tricks that conserve time, like pre-labelled medicine storage and rehearsed discharge lines for toddlers.

Assessment, certificates, and refresher cycles

Assessment consists of straight observation, useful jobs, and brief understanding checks. You must show continual CPR for a minimum of 2 mins on an adult manikin on the flooring. Lots of service providers require 2 mins on a baby manikin as well. For bleeding, you will apply a pressure plaster or tourniquet. For anaphylaxis, you will certainly mimic carrying out an auto-injector.

Certificates arrive digitally, typically within 1 day, often very same day if admin cut-offs are fulfilled. They provide the certain devices achieved. Employers look for HLTAID009, HLTAID011, or HLTAID012 depending upon the role.

CPR currency is commonly one year. Emergency treatment legitimacy is frequently 3 years, however many offices ask for annual mouth-to-mouth resuscitation refreshers and a full first aid update every 3 years. Education and treatment setups frequently anticipate yearly refresher courses on anaphylaxis and asthma management, in addition to HLTAID012 money. Build schedule tips 11 months after a CPR course Cannon Hillside session so you can reserve before expiry.

AEDs around Cannon Hill and why that issues in training

Most emergency treatment training courses include AED usage, but few explain how to plan for real access. Map the AEDs near your common haunts: shopping center, health clubs, council facilities, certain offices. More recent tools speak guidelines out loud and analyse rhythm immediately. The barrier is hardly ever operation, it is time. Throughout training, method handing over: you start compressions, someone else calls Triple No, a 3rd individual fetches the AED. Revolve those roles so you can do any one of them under stress.

I have actually seen onlookers delay AED application while waiting on a manager to unlock a cabinet. Educating gives you the self-confidence to press back: minutes count, unlock it currently, bring it right here, scissors and pads prepared. That assertiveness conserves lives.

Common errors first-timers make

People overthink causes, underuse AEDs, and forget the basics. I have actually watched solid individuals deliver attractive compressions while the AED rested unopened two metres away. Others miss the security check around electrical hazards, particularly in wet areas.

Another mistake is tight bandaging over joints that swells and cuts flow. In training, do the capillary refill examination on a finger or toe past your bandage. If refill is slow-moving or the area turns pale and cold, loosen and retie.

Parents typically are reluctant with baby choking protocols. Training aids you rely on the method: five back strikes, five chest thrusts, examine, repeat, and call for assistance early. Practicing on infant manikins constructs the muscle mass memory for hand position and force.
